Q: Is 196,176,177 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 196,176,177 is a composite number.

Why is 196,176,177 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 196,176,177 can be evenly divided by 1 3 9 23 69 207 947,711 2,843,133 8,529,399 21,797,353 65,392,059 and 196,176,177, with no remainder.

Since 196,176,177 cannot be divided by just 1 and 196,176,177, it is a composite number.
